A função DECIMAL converte a representação do texto de um número noutra base numa base 10 (decimal).
Partes de uma fórmula DECIMAL
DECIMAL(valor; base)
Parte | Descrição | Notas |
valor |
O valor sem sinal a ser convertido para o sistema decimal, fornecido como uma string. | |
base |
A base (ou base de numeração) para a qual converter o número. | A base é um número inteiro de 2 a 36. |
Fórmula de amostra
DECIMAL(101;2)
Notas
- É utilizada a representação de string do valor, a qual deve conter apenas carateres numéricos (ou seja, a notação científica não é permitida). O texto de uma string não deve ter mais de 255 carateres.
- A função DECIMAL só é convertida em números inteiros positivos.
Exemplo
A | B | |
1 | Fórmula | Resultado |
2 | =DECIMAL(101;2) | 5 |
Funções relacionadas
- BASE: A função BASE converte um número decimal numa representação de texto noutra base.
- BINADEC: A função BINADEC converte um número binário com sinal para o sistema decimal.
- BINAHEX: A função BINAHEX converte um número binário com sinal para o sistema hexadecimal com sinal.
- BINAOCT: A função BINAOCT converte um número binário com sinal para o sistema octal com sinal.
- OCTABIN: A função OCTABIN converte um número octal com sinal para o sistema binário com sinal.
- OCTADEC: A função OCTADEC converte um número octal com sinal para o sistema decimal.
- OCTAHEX: A função OCTAHEX converte um número octal com sinal para o sistema hexadecimal com sinal.
- DECABIN: A função DECABIN converte um número decimal para o sistema binário com sinal.
- DECAOCT: A função DECAOCT converte um número decimal para o sistema octal com sinal.
- DECAHEX: A função DECAHEX converte um número decimal para o sistema hexadecimal com sinal.
- HEXADEC: A função HEXADEC converte um número hexadecimal com sinal para o sistema decimal.
- HEXABIN: A função HEXABIN converte um número hexadecimal com sinal para o sistema binário com sinal.
- HEXAOCT: A função HEXAOCT converte um número hexadecimal com sinal para o sistema octal com sinal.